Are you a passionate and fully credentialed Speech Language Pathologist or a recent graduate eager to complete your Clinical Fellowship? Cross Country Education is searching for Speech Language Pathologists in Fort Lauderdale, FL for the '25-'26 school year!
Position Overview:- Provide targeted speech and language interventions and diagnostic evaluations to students spanning Elementary through High School, serving learners in traditional and non-traditional settings.
- Oversee an estimated standard caseload of 50 students while managing all aspects of the IEP process—including developing, writing, and monitoring measurable goals, with assignments available for both Full-Time and Part-Time commitment.
- Collaborate with teachers, parents, and multidisciplinary teams in diverse educational settings to help students achieve their developmental and academic goals.
- Master's Degree in Speech-Language Pathology
- Active Florida License in Speech-Language Pathology or Audiology, issued by the Florida Department of Health (DOH) (Required)
- Clinical Fellows Welcome: CF candidates are encouraged to apply. Consideration is contingent upon successful agreement regarding the provision of the required clinical supervision.
- Prior successful experience managing a diverse caseload spanning Elementary through High School (K-12) students (Preferred)
